    foundation ingredient to beer. Grist: Brewers’ term for milled grains‚ sometimes applied to hops primarily used for a particular brew. Mash: To release malt sugars by soaking the grains in water. Mash Tun: Tank where mashing goes on. Wort: The solution of grain sugars strained from the mash tun. This stage‚ regarded as “sweet wort”‚ later as “brewed wort”‚ “fermenting wort”‚ and finally beer.     Mtunzini (Mm-tun-zee-nee) is a small coastal town that is situated almost exactly halfway along KwaZulu-Natal’s coastline in South Africa approximately 140 km north of Durban. The name is an isiZulu word meaning place in the shade. After the breakup of the Zulu Kingdom after the Anglo-Zulu War‚ Sir Garnet Wolseley created 13 ’kinglets’ - with two strategically located as buffer zones between Port Natal and Zululand.
